Great Museum

The Addison Gallery is home to a world-class collection of American Art, along with a vital and adventurous exhibitions program. The museum is committed to serving the public through free admission and an education outreach program that reaches diverse audiences. The Addison’s size gives visitors an opportunity to experience its wide-ranging exhibitions in a more intimate setting than typical of larger museums. The Addison is just 30 minutes from Boston.

  • 5Travelandfood 5:00 PM Jun 4, 2022
    A must visit in Andover, MA
    The Addison Gallery is a great place to visit if you stop by Andover, Massachusetts. It is part of the worldwide known Phillips Academy (PA) Boarding School. During the school year, the gallery offers several different exhibitions of American art.

    Classic American Artwork & Ship Collection
    Looking for classical American Artwork and colonial decor? Then, this is the place! Located in Andover at the Phillips Academy, this museum offers free admission with a moderate collection of artwork. The collections are located on two floors... You'll find tall case clocks and portraiture. I loved the open and very accessible library. For me, the best part of the museum is the collection of model ships. Wow! One of the best is housed in the library. Tragically, most of the ships are hidden in the basement in narrow corridors leading to the office space. I suspect that most visitors never go the basement...that's where the restrooms are and this was a treasure. The Addison could easily move that ship collection to the spacious meeting space adjacent to the library... Why are we hiding these beautiful ships. This is definitely a museum to visit: then stroll outside around the Academy's grounds.
